ABSTRACT

In this study, we present a one-step method for fabrication of silver nanoparticles decorated on the structured silicon surface by using circularly polarized fs laser irradiation in silver nitrate solution (AgNO3) and demonstrate its ability for SERS for the first time. The silver nanoparticles are uniformly formed on the nanostructured silicon surface with a mean diameter of 66 nm, which is suitable for exciting localized surface plasmon at the visible light range for related applications. When compared to the multi-step approaches, the one-step approach we proposed to obtain the silver nanoparticle-covered SERS-active substrates is much more simple and efficient.
